Can anybody please tell me the rights on cutting back the nieghbours hedge on my side of the fence line

But you must not keep the clippings - they are your neighbours' and should be returned.
Agree with Ethel- except I would offer the neighbour the clippings rather than just return them without their agreement. Chances are, the neighbour won't want them. I wasn't too pleased when my neighbour dumped them in piles in my garden and they blew all over my lawn.
You can only cut back to your fence line (and no further). You must offer the clippings back but they don't have to accept them.

If you pay someone to trim your side it is at your own expence.
